
Late actor Rico Yan may have long passed away, but his memory to those who left behind continues to live on as former girlfriend Claudine Barretto marked his 46th birthday on Sunday, March 14.
On Instagram, The 41-year-old actress held a feast at her home as a way to remember him.
She said in one of her posts, “So since it's the birthday of Rico [Yan], we wanted to celebrate and remember him kaya magkakaroon kami ng konting salu-salo dito sa bahay.”
The actress's friends and family members joined her in prayer and song as Claudine greeted her ex-boyfriend.
“Happy birthday, Rico,” she said.
“We love you, and we will not forget you. Just keep watching over us. In Jesus' mighty name. Amen.”

Aside from Claudine, other celebrity friends of Rico Yan also commemorated his birthday by sharing photos from their memories and said how they missed his presence.
Actor Dominic Ochoa wrote on his Instagram account, “It's something we have in common, our passion for cars and bikes.
“Taken Sunday after his birthday, more than 30 cars joined, his last fun run to Tags. We switched cars. He drove my [Mini] Cooper, and I drove his HKS turbo Miata. Fun times, buddy! Happy, happy RY. #march172002 #philippineautosportcouncil.”
Meanwhile, restaurateur and actor Marvin Agustin shared a clip of one of his films with Rico, which he transformed into a TikTok video.
Rico Yan died of cardiac arrest due to acute hemorrhagic pancreatitis back on March 29, 2002. He was found dead inside his hotel room by Dominic Ochoa at the Dos Palmas Resort in Puerto Princesa in Palawan.
Since his untimely death, Claudine has always declared her love for him in various social media posts.
